Delfouneso could not inspire Villa's youngsters to victory over Arsenal
Aston Villa bowed out of the FA Youth Cup at the third round stage, beaten 3-2 by Arsenal at Villa Park.
Striker James Collins had twice put the home side in front, first capitalising on a weak punch, then drilling home his second from 15 yards out.
But Arsenal battled back with a pair of goals from Rhys Murphy, before Jay Thomas secured victory on 80 minutes.
Nathan Delfouneso was in the Villa side, a week after his first senior goal against Zilina in the Uefa Cup.
The striker is set to return to the first-team squad for Saturday's Premier League fixture at home to Bolton as cover for England striker Gabriel Agbonlahor.
